Output 6cb8b5a945964aaf51bf4361ca6a1934437fb0142e01827934df4a6ac9d3ed9c:2

value
20297974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5712f5dd9f85be064fe7c1787d705afe5ffe3f7 OP_EQUAL
address
MRu8wTJKxNZH4EEM18pHrZkd3TfkG6jS1w
transaction
6cb8b5a945964aaf51bf4361ca6a1934437fb0142e01827934df4a6ac9d3ed9c
spent
true